The scenario of confronting with Windows updates that are not working properly are numerous.
Certain users experience the lack of any new install updates, repeated installation of the same updates, endless reboot cycles, and all sorts of error codes. For example, they describe getting the 0x80244007 error code.
This happens when they try to install certain updates by using the Windows Update function. In most cases, affected users are also receiving the following error message: There were some problems installing updates, but we’ll try again later.

2. Clean out junk files with Disk Cleanup
One of the main causes of the Windows update error 0x80244007 is that Windows couldn’t renew the cookies for Windows Update. If you’re still seeing that dreadful message, you can also clear temporary or junk files to resolve it via Disk Cleanup.
